This Professional Certificate in Lightweighting Strategies for Electric Vehicles equips participants with the knowledge and skills to optimize EV design for enhanced performance and efficiency. The program focuses on reducing vehicle weight through material selection and advanced manufacturing techniques, directly impacting range, energy consumption, and overall cost.
Learning outcomes include a deep understanding of lightweighting materials (such as aluminum alloys, composites, and high-strength steels), advanced manufacturing processes (like additive manufacturing and forming techniques), and the application of lightweighting principles to various EV components (including body structures, chassis, and powertrains). Participants will also develop proficiency in CAE simulation and optimization strategies crucial for successful lightweighting design.

Professional Certificate in Lightweighting Strategies for Electric Vehicles is increasingly significant in the UK's burgeoning EV sector. The UK government aims for all new car sales to be zero-emission by 2030, driving immense demand for expertise in lightweighting, crucial for extending EV range and improving efficiency. According to the Society of Motor Manufacturers and Traders (SMMT), battery electric vehicle registrations in the UK reached a record high of 190,000 in 2022. This growth necessitates professionals skilled in optimizing vehicle weight through advanced materials and design. The certificate empowers individuals with the knowledge and skills to tackle these challenges, leveraging innovative lightweighting materials like carbon fiber composites and aluminum alloys, contributing to a sustainable and efficient automotive industry.
